Ethiopian Cuisine: A Delicious Journey Through the Supply Chain

Ethiopian cuisine is renowned for its flavorful dishes, unique combinations of spices, and communal style of eating. From injera (a spongy flatbread) to spicy stews and aromatic coffee, Ethiopian food offers a diverse and vibrant culinary experience. In this blog post, we will explore the supply chain of Ethiopian cuisine, from the sourcing of ingredients to the preparation of traditional dishes. Sourcing Ingredients: The first step in the supply chain of Ethiopian cuisine is sourcing high-quality ingredients. Ethiopia is known for its diverse agriculture, with crops such as teff, lentils, and various spices being staples in Ethiopian cooking. Teff, a gluten-free grain used to make injera, is one of the most important crops in Ethiopian cuisine. Farmers play a crucial role in the supply chain by growing and harvesting these ingredients, ensuring their freshness and quality. Transportation and Distribution: Once the ingredients are sourced, they need to be transported to markets, restaurants, and homes. The transportation and distribution of ingredients in Ethiopia can be challenging due to the country's diverse terrain and infrastructure limitations. However, small-scale farmers often rely on local markets and informal networks to distribute their goods, ensuring the availability of fresh ingredients to consumers. Food Preparation: The next stage in the supply chain of Ethiopian cuisine is food preparation. Ethiopian cooking is characterized by its use of spices such as berbere (a hot spice blend) and mitmita (a spicy chili powder), which add depth and flavor to dishes. Traditional cooking methods, such as slow simmering of stews and roasting of coffee beans, require skill and expertise to create the rich and complex flavors that Ethiopian cuisine is known for. Restaurant Experience: Ethiopian cuisine is often enjoyed in a communal setting, with diners sharing platters of food served on a large piece of injera. The restaurant experience is an essential part of Ethiopian food culture, bringing people together to enjoy delicious dishes and engage in lively conversation. Restaurants play a vital role in the supply chain by providing a space for people to experience and appreciate Ethiopian cuisine. Ethiopian cuisine is a reflection of the country's rich history, culture, and culinary traditions. By understanding the supply chain of Ethiopian cuisine, we can appreciate the hard work and dedication that goes into creating these delicious dishes. From sourcing ingredients to food preparation and restaurant experience, each step in the supply chain contributes to the vibrant and diverse world of Ethiopian cuisine. So next time you savor a bite of injera or taste a spicy stew, remember the journey that these flavors have taken from farm to table.
